1. Read the passage carefully:Meera loved Sundays because she helped her grandmother at their family bakery. One morning, Meera had a brilliant idea. 'Grandma, what if we bake a cake with mango, coconut, and honey?' she asked eagerly. Her grandmother smiled warmly and said, 'That sounds wonderful!' Meera carefully measured the ingredients and mixed them together. They poured the batter into a pan and placed it in the oven. The whole kitchen filled with a sweet, tropical smell.When the cake was ready, their neighbour Mr. Sharma tasted it and said it was the most delicious cake he had ever eaten. Word spread quickly through the neighbourhood, and soon people lined up outside the bakery to get a slice. Everyone praised Meera's creativity.At the end of the day, Meera sat with her grandmother, sharing the last slice of the mango coconut honey cake.
